Ministry of Finance: GST council in its 38th meeting on 18 Dec 2019 had recommended that late fee chargeable on filing of statements of output supplies in Form GSTR-1s, be waived for the GSTR-1 pertaining to period July, 2017 to Nov 2019 if the same are filed by 10 Jan 2020. In the view of huge response, which would lead reduction in unmatched credit, it has been decided to extend the said amnesty scheme from 10th January 2020 to 17th January 2020.

Delhi Police addresses press conference on JNU violence
Aishe Ghosh, the JNU students’ union president was named by Delhi Police as one of the nine suspects identified by them in connection with the violence on the JNU campus on Sunday evening. In a joint presser, DCP/Crime Joy Tirkey said that JNU Students' Union President Aishe Ghosh led the mob that attacked the Periyar hostel on the evening of January 5. "Three cases have been registered till now and they are being investigated by us," said Tirkey.

10:48 AM (IST)Jan 10, 2020
Freedom of internet access is fundamental right: SC
Supreme Court while delivering verdict on a batch of petitions on situation in J&K after abrogation of Article 370 said: "Kashmir has seen a lot of violence. We will try our best to balance the human rights and freedoms with the issue of security."
"Supreme Court while delivering verdict on petitions on situation in J&K after abrogation of Article 370: It is no doubt that freedom of speech is an essential tool in a democratic set up.Freedom of Internet access is a fundamental right under Article 19(1)(a) of free speech," it added.
